Volkswagen states vehicle industry headwinds mean the German automaker can't dismiss plant closings in its home nation, while the firm is also dropping a historical project protection promise that will have prevented unemployments through 2029." The International automotive market is in an extremely demanding and severe scenario," Oliver Blume, Volkswagen Team chief executive officer, pointed out in a claim Monday.He pointed out brand-new rivals entering the International markets, Germany's falling apart setting as a manufacturing area and also the requirement to "behave decisively.".
A Volkwagen vegetation closure in Germany will mark the very first time the automaker, which was developed in 1937, had actually finalized a residential manufacturing facility, according to Bloomberg Headlines. It will additionally be actually the very first time the firm had actually shuttered some of its own factory considering that its USA facility in Westmoreland, Pennsylvania, closed in 1988, the dpa news organisation reported.Thomas Schaefer, the Chief Executive Officer of the Volkswagen Auto department, claimed attempts to decrease prices were "yielding outcomes" but that the "headwinds have actually become considerably stronger.".
Positioning competition from ChinaEuropean car manufacturers are facing raised competition coming from affordable Mandarin power vehicles. Volkswagen's half-year results suggest it will definitely certainly not attain its own intended for 10 billion europeans ($ 11 billion) in price discounts through 2026, the business claimed. The discussion around closures and also layoffs is for the firm's core Volkswagen brand. The brand name found operating earnings droop to 966 thousand euros ($ 1.1 billion) coming from 1.64 billion europeans in the year-earlier time frame. The team additionally consists of high-end helps make Audi as well as Porsche, which have higher earnings margins than the mass-market automobiles made through Volkswagen, as well as SEAT as well as Skoda. The firm has actually sought to cut costs by means of early retirements and purchases that stay clear of required layoffs, however is actually now claiming those actions might certainly not suffice. Volkswagen possesses some 120,000 laborers in Germany.
Alliance representatives and also laborer representatives attacked the concept of closings or even discharges. Administration's strategy is "certainly not merely imprudent, but dangerous, as it takes the chance of ruining the soul of Volkswagen," Thorsten Groeger, chief negotiator along with VW for the IG Metall commercial union, claimed on the alliance's website.Top worker representative Daniela Cavallo mentioned that "administration has actually fallen short ... The repercussion is actually an attack on our staff members, our locations as well as our work force arrangements. There will be actually no vegetation closings with our company." The guv of Germany's Lower Saxony region, Stephan Weil, that sits on the business's panel of directors, concurred the firm required to respond yet contacted Volkswagen to stay clear of plant closings by relying on alternate techniques to minimize expenses: "The condition authorities are going to pay out specifically close attention to that," he claimed in a statement mentioned by the dpa news organisation.

The European Union in July transferred to establish provisional tariffs on Mandarin EVs, although the EU will just collect the levies if talks along with Beijing fall short to surrender a trade package. The tolls would contain 17.4% on vehicles from BYD, 19.9% coming from Geely and 37.6% for lorries transported by China's state-owned SAIC. Geely's brand names include Polestar and also Sweden's Volvo, while SAIC possesses Britain's MG.President Joe Biden in May announced tolls of around one hundred% on Mandarin EVs, quadrupling the present toll of 25%..
